The KangaNews New Zealand Debt Capital Market Summit is the pinnacle event in the New Zealand debt capital markets calendar, showcasing views from a wide range of issuers, investors and intermediaries. Now in its ninth year, this event should not be missed by any market participants with an interest in debt capital markets.

     

This event is taking place on 7 and 8 December 2021 virtually through the KangaNews OnAIR portal. Attendance is strictly by registration only.

Registration is free if you are an investor, issuer/borrower or company looking to access financing, or government body (eg ministry, central bank).

For event registration purposes KangaNews defines investors as people who invest solely on behalf of themselves or their own firm, and issuers/borrowers as people who issue solely on behalf of their own firm. If the job function of a delegate includes investing or issuing/borrowing on behalf of third-party clients, the individual does not qualify as a bona fide investor or issuer for registration purposes. Issuer/borrower, investor and government/regulator passes are not applicable to broker/dealers, traders, structurers, arrangers, lawyers, accountants, trustees, rating agency analysts, or other third-party service providers.
